I am curious about how top scholars or passionate physicists approach a new topic or a chapter. Do they just dive right in or they do something else before approaching the topic? What's their method of working? Also, I want to know the significance of online videos in understanding a topic. How much they refer them. Thanks!

I should think they read it, think about it, research it further online, and go back to reading it again and then most importantly doing some problems to cement their understanding.

Did I mention researching whenever you're stuck or confused especially while trying to solve a problem?

Your learning must be proactive, active, and hands-on.
